d47d29a622 drm/i915/display: Convert gen5/gen6 tests to IS_IRONLAKE/IS_SANDYBRIDGE
ILK is the only platform that we consider "gen5" and SNB is the only
platform we consider "gen6."  Add an IS_SANDYBRIDGE() macro and then
replace numeric platform tests for these two generations with direct
platform tests with the following Coccinelle semantic patch:

        @@ expression dev_priv; @@
        - IS_GEN(dev_priv, 5)
        + IS_IRONLAKE(dev_priv)

        @@ expression dev_priv; @@
        - IS_GEN(dev_priv, 6)
        + IS_SANDYBRIDGE(dev_priv)

        @@ expression dev_priv; @@
        - IS_GEN_RANGE(dev_priv, 5, 6)
        + IS_IRONLAKE(dev_priv) || IS_SANDYBRIDGE(dev_priv)

This will simplify our upcoming patches which eliminate INTEL_GEN()
usage in the display code.

97b70144b2 drm/i915/pps: refactor init abstractions
Once you realize there is no need to hold the pps mutex when calling
pps_init_timestamps() in intel_pps_init(), we can reuse
intel_pps_encoder_reset() which has the same code.

Since intel_dp_pps_init() is only called from one place now, move it
inline to remove one "init" function altogether.

Finally, remove some initialization from
vlv_initial_power_sequencer_setup() and do it in the caller to highlight
the similarity, not the difference, in the platforms.
